Transaction 7662fc362cf5177cf33c56dbde0757859f6ecf4b905a1f2d6d5894a12525e3e9

3 Input
2 Outputs
  • 7662fc362cf5177cf33c56dbde0757859f6ecf4b905a1f2d6d5894a12525e3e9:0
  • value  80000
    address  2N6x4smwgEshqeR4eevKDDgo7eSUjUz131w
  • 7662fc362cf5177cf33c56dbde0757859f6ecf4b905a1f2d6d5894a12525e3e9:1
  • value  108945
    address  mtFDgYrXpGHeAWCUN8abVy3zdcxMJrfZw1